For the 2026 school year, there is 1 special education public school serving 112 students in Iowa.
The top-ranked special education public school in Iowa is Ruby Van Meter. Overall testing rank is based on a school's combined math and reading proficiency test score ranking.
Iowa special education public school have an average math proficiency score of 10% (versus the Iowa public school average of 68%), and reading proficiency score of 10% (versus the 70% statewide average).
Minority enrollment is 50% of the student body (majority Hispanic), which is more than the Iowa public school average of 29% (majority Hispanic).
